Abstract
869,889. Plate heat exchangers. PARSONS & CO. Ltd., C.A. Oct. 17, 1958 [Oct. 31, 1957], No. 34055/57. Class 64(3) A plate heat exchanger comprising a series of cells each consisting of a flat plate 1 and two side walls 2a which define a flow channel through the cell having inlets and outlets which are angularly displaced from the line of direction of the flow channel, adjacent cells being reversed so that the inlet and outlet openings of adjacent cells are angularly displaced, the flow channel being subdivided into a plurality of smaller channels by a corrugated plate 3a is characterized by headers 5 for a heat exchanging fluid being bonded e.g. by welding to the element inlets and outlets. The fluid is supplied to the ducts through pipe 6, a method of forming the ducts 5 and pipe in one piece being described. Cleaning fluid may be supplied to the plates through pipe 15 and slits 11 and 12. Two series of cells having the same headers may be used in which case they are separated by an asbestos pad. Specifications 718,991 and 732,977 are referred to.
